About the YUL–PRG route
The Montréal to Prague route crosses the North Atlantic, where the jet stream is the primary source of turbulence. Flying at 37,000 feet, the aircraft encounters the strongest bumps roughly 2–5 hours into the flight. This is clear-air turbulence — no clouds, no visual warning — which makes a pre-flight forecast especially valuable.

Turbulence levels on YUL–PRG
What to expect at each phase of the flight
SmoothDeparture & arrival — climb and descent phases are generally calm
LightMinor bumps — drink stays in your cup, walking feels slightly unsteady
ModerateNoticeable bumps — stay seated with seatbelt on, service may pause
HeavyStrong jolts — unsecured items move, crew seated. Rare but possible

Which seat is smoothest on YUL to PRG?
Wing seats are always the smoothest. On a Boeing 757 (the most common aircraft on this route), that's rows 14–24. Avoid the very rear of the aircraft — it amplifies turbulence motion.

Data Sources
- PIREP — Pilot reports (PIREPs) submitted via FAA/ICAO systems, aggregated over 12+ months of historical data
- SIGMET / AIRMET — Significant Meteorological Information bulletins from NOAA Aviation Weather Center
- EDR data — Eddy Dissipation Rate measurements from commercial aircraft (ADS-B derived turbulence intensity)
- Seasonal patterns — 5-year rolling averages of turbulence frequency and intensity by month for this route
